auth: Rename `timestampThreshold` to `tokenValidityDuration`
The `timestampThreshold` records how long a token is going to stay valid
for authentication purposes. It's not quite obvious going by its name,
so let's rename it to `tokenValidityDuration` to hopefullymake its
purpose a bit more obvious.
